1. 1 Reserator (Reservoir + Radiator + Water Pump)
“Reserator” is a compound word deri ed from ‘Reser oir’ and
‘Radiator’ - it acts as a reser oir while radiating heat. This product
works well with natural con ection and integrates a water pump
inside for con enience.
1. 2 CPU Water Block (ZM-WB Gold)
The CPU Water Block incorporates a pure copper base for excellent
heat transfer, and has gold plating to pre ent corrosion. It supports
Pentium 4 Socket 775/478 CPU and AMD Socket 754/939/940 CPU,
and is designed to be light weight and easy to install.
1. 3 VGA Water Block (ZM-GWB3)
The VGA Water Block incorporates a light weight pure aluminum base
for high cooling performance, and is anodized and coated to pre ent
corrosion. It also incorporates re ol ing fittings that pro ide freedom in
direction when connecting them with the tubes, which further allows
simple installation.
1. Northbridge Water Block (ZM-NWB1, Optional)
This anodized, pure aluminum block is built for high performance cooling, and is
designed for compatibility with a wide ariety of northbridge chipsets.
1. 5 VGA RAM Water Block (ZM-RWB1, Optional)
This anodized, pure aluminum RAM Water Block is built for high
performance cooling, and is compatible with Geforce 7800/7900 and ATI
X1800/X1900 in need of VGA RAM cooling. It pro ides easy installation.
1. 6 Anti-Corrosion Coolant (ZM-G200)
This coolant contains a high quality anti-corrosion agent for arious
materials including copper, aluminum, and plastic, that pre ents
corrosion for long term operation.
1. 7 Flow Indicator
This component is connected in-line with the circulation tube for
checking the circulation of the coolant. When the coolant is acti ely
circulating, the cap inside the flow indicator shakes rapidly, pro iding
easy indication of the circulation status.
1. 8 Quick Coupling
The Fittings incorporate al es that pre ent leaks when disconnecting
the PVC Tubes allowing quick, con enient separation and reassembly of
the Reserator for transport and coolant replacement.
